Colleges near Poughkeepsie NY: comparing real value
There are 17 colleges near Poughkeepsie, NY-6 public and 11 private schools-with 4 located within the city limits and 13 within 30 miles. The top choices are Marist College (6,452 students, $46,010 tuition), Vassar College (2,456 students, $67,805 tuition), Dutchess Community College (6,387 students, $5,346 in-state tuition), Culinary Institute of America (3.6 miles away), and SUNY New Paltz (8.9 miles away).
Core colleges in Poughkeepsie city limits
Four institutions operate directly in Poughkeepsie, offering the most accessible options for local students. Marist College, a private not-for-profit four-year school founded in 1929, enrolls 6,452 students with a 16:1 student-faculty ratio and 56.5% acceptance rate. Vassar College, an elite private liberal arts college founded in 1861, serves 2,456 students with an 8:1 ratio and 18.6% acceptance rate, ranked 48th nationally. Dutchess Community College, a public 2-4 year institution, enrolls 6,387 students with a 20:1 ratio and offers the most affordable tuition at $5,346 for NY residents.
Nearby colleges within 30 miles
Thirteen additional colleges fall within a 30-mile radius, expanding choices for specialized programs and different price points. The Culinary Institute of America sits 3.6 miles away in Hyde Park with 3,104 students and $37,240 tuition. SUNY New Paltz is 8.9 miles away with 7,420 students and $8,524 in-state tuition. Mount Saint Mary College (13.4 miles) offers Catholic higher education with 2,246 students. West Point's United States Military Academy is 21.2 miles away with 4,508 cadets and a 7:1 ratio.
- Culinary Institute of America: 3.6 miles, $37,240 tuition, 19:1 ratio
- SUNY New Paltz: 8.9 miles, $8,524 in-state tuition, 16:1 ratio
- Mount Saint Mary College: 13.4 miles, $41,370 tuition, Catholic affiliation
- Ulster County Community College: 15.2 miles, $6,376 in-state tuition
- United States Military Academy (West Point): 21.2 miles, free tuition, 7:1 ratio
- Bard College: 22.5 miles, $63,612 tuition, 9:1 ratio
Tuition comparison and value analysis
Understanding real educational value requires comparing tuition against outcomes. The average 2024 tuition across all 17 schools is $25,036 for out-of-state students. Private four-year colleges range from $46,010 (Marist) to $67,805 (Vassar), while public options like SUNY New Paltz offer $8,524 in-state rates. Community colleges provide the most cost-effective entry at $5,346, with transfer pathways to four-year institutions.
| School Name | Distance | Type | Undergraduate Tuition | Enrollment | Student-Faculty Ratio | Acceptance Rate |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Vassar College | In city | Private 4-year | $67,805 | 2,456 | 8:1 | 18.6% |
| Marist College | In city | Private 4-year | $46,010 | 6,452 | 16:1 | 56.5% |
| Dutchess Community College | In city | Public 2-4 year | $5,346 (in-state) | 6,387 | 20:1 | Open |
| Culinary Institute of America | 3.6 miles | Private 4-year | $37,240 | 3,104 | 19:1 | Na |
| SUNY New Paltz | 8.9 miles | Public 4-year | $8,524 (in-state) | 7,420 | 16:1 | Na |
| Mount Saint Mary College | 13.4 miles | Private 4-year | $41,370 | 2,246 | 12:1 | Na |
| United States Military Academy | 21.2 miles | Public 4-year | Free | 4,508 | 7:1 | 11% |
| Bard College | 22.5 miles | Private 4-year | $63,612 | 2,922 | 9:1 | Na |
Key factors for choosing the right college
Students should evaluate academic fit beyond just distance and cost. Marist College emphasizes business, communications, and nursing with strong industry connections in the Hudson Valley. Vassar focuses on liberal arts with rigorous humanities programs and ranked highly nationally. Dutchess Community College serves transfer students and career-focused learners with practical nursing programs. The Culinary Institute of America dominates culinary arts with global campuses.

Admission statistics and enrollment trends
The average acceptance rate across all 17 colleges is 63.38%, with average SAT scores for enrolled students at 1,284. Vassar's 18.6% acceptance rate reflects its elite status, while Marist's 56.5% rate indicates broader accessibility. Total enrollment across all schools reaches 42,116 students, demonstrating the Hudson Valley's robust higher education ecosystem. Seven schools offer graduate programs, expanding opportunities for advanced study.

Program specialization by institution
Engineering programs are primarily offered through Dutchess Community College with three engineering programs, though quality ratings show two stars for curriculum and three stars for teaching. For specialized culinary arts, the Culinary Institute of America remains the regional leader with global recognition. Business and communications thrive at Marist College, while liberal arts excellence defines Vassar. SUNY New Paltz provides strong public university options with diverse majors.

What is the best college near Poughkeepsie NY?
Vassar College ranks highest nationally (48th) with the most selective admission (18.6%) and smallest class sizes (8:1), while Marist College offers the best value for business/communications with 6,452 students and strong Hudson Valley industry ties.
Is there a community college in Poughkeepsie NY?
Yes, Dutchess Community College (DCC) is located in Poughkeepsie at 53 Pendell Road, offering undergraduate programs with $5,346 in-state tuition and 6,387 enrolled students.
What Catholic colleges are near Poughkeepsie?
Mount Saint Mary College, located 13.4 miles away in Newburgh, is the primary Catholic four-year institution with 2,246 students and $41,370 tuition, emphasizing faith-based education aligned with Marist values.
How far is West Point from Poughkeepsie?
The United States Military Academy at West Point is 21.2 miles from Poughkeepsie, offering free tuition to admitted cadets with 4,508 students and an exceptional 7:1 student-faculty ratio.
